Shah Rukh Khan injured on King set during action scene. Mamata Banerjee tweets concern, calling SRK her brother and wishing him a speedy recovery.
Shah Rukh Khan, who is currently filming his upcoming action thriller King, recently suffered a back injury during an intense stunt sequence. The news has sparked widespread concern across the country, with fans and public figures sending in their wishes for a speedy recovery. Among them is West Bengal Chief Minister Mamata Banerjee, who referred to the actor as her 'brother" in an emotional social media post.
Taking to her official X (formerly Twitter) handle on July 19, Mamata Banerjee wrote, 'Reports regarding my brother Shah Rukh Khan sustaining muscular injuries during shooting make me worried. Wish him speedy recovery." Her heartfelt tweet has since gone viral, with fans applauding the Chief Minister's warmth and concern for the beloved star.
According to a Bollywood Hungama report, the incident occurred at Golden Tobacco studio in Mumbai, where SRK was filming an action-heavy sequence for King, a high-octane film directed by Siddharth Anand and co-starring his daughter, Suhana Khan. The superstar sustained a muscular strain, likely caused by years of physically demanding stunts.
Following the injury, Shah Rukh initially travelled to the United States for medical attention and has now shifted to the United Kingdom, where he is recuperating with his family. He has also postponed a planned visit to Sri Lanka to focus on rest and recovery.
'It's not a serious injury, but more of a muscular strain," a source close to the production revealed. 'Given his past injuries from action films, the team opted for precautionary care abroad."
As a result, the shoot schedules for July and August at Film City, Golden Tobacco, and YRF Studios have been cancelled. The next leg of filming is expected to begin around September or October.
While the production house is yet to issue an official statement, industry insiders suggest that King will feature an ensemble cast including Deepika Padukone, Abhishek Bachchan, Rani Mukerji, Anil Kapoor, Jackie Shroff, Arshad Warsi, Raghav Juyal, and Abhay Verma. The film is being positioned as one of the most ambitious projects in Shah Rukh's career and marks a significant milestone as Suhana Khan makes her big-screen debut opposite her father.

Kantara, the 2022 movie starring Rishab Shetty in the lead role, was an action thriller with elements of mythology. Its prequel, Kantara: Chapter 1, is releasing in theaters on October 2, 2025. What does its story revolve around, and how will it be connected to the first installment? Let's find out inside. What is the story of Kantara: Chapter 1? According to a report by Bollywood Hungama, Kantara: Chapter 1 will revolve around lost ancient traditions from the Tulu region in Karnataka. The prequel film would delve deeper into the lore of Panjurli Daiva and Guliga Daiva deities, making it a thematic connection to the first installment. While the original movie explored just a simple insight into the facets of Panjurli Daiva, this would be more detailed and said to become a one-of-a-kind experience in Indian cinema. Set in pre-colonial coastal Karnataka, the film is touted to be a man's exploration into the connected experiences of nature and divinity under the rule of Kadambas of Banavasi. This was initially teased as the backstory for the ancestral conflict in Kantara (2022). What was the Kadamba dynasty? The Kadamba dynasty was an ancient royal family that ruled northern Karnataka and the Konkan from Banavasi. Founded by Maharaja Mayurasharma in 345 CE, the dynasty lasted 540 CE until being disestablished. What are the Panjurli Daiva and Guliga Daiva deities? According to Tulu folklore, Panjurli Daiva and Guliga Daiva are two deities popularly known from the shamanistic Hindu dance Buta Kola, worshipped in Karnataka. Panjurli is represented as a boar-like demigod who is known for protecting the people and their crops. As legend goes, it is believed that Lord Shiva and Goddess Parvati once adopted a boar, but as it grew older, it became destructive. This led Lord Shiva to send him to Earth and become a protector god. On the other hand, Guliga Daiva is represented as a spirit much more powerful and ferocious than Panjurli. Often blamed for bringing diseases, misfortune, and chaos, Guliga Daiva's legend describes it as being cursed by Lord Vishnu and sent to Earth. Kantara: Chapter 1 is a mythological action thriller starring, written, and directed by Rishab Shetty. The film, slated to release for October this year, is musically crafted by Ajaneesh Lokanath.

Bollywood actor Aamir Khan has publicly dismissed recent speculation that he is planning a film based on the high-profile Meghalaya murder case. In a candid interview with Bollywood Hungama, Khan addressed the circulating rumours head-on and clarified his stance on the matter. 'There is no truth to these reports,' the actor said firmly. 'I honestly don't know where these stories start.' The rumours had been steadily gaining traction, with various outlets suggesting that Khan was not only conceptualising a film inspired by the case but was also actively monitoring developments related to it. The buzz intensified after a Times Now report cited unnamed sources allegedly close to Khan, claiming, 'Aamir Khan is closely following the updates on the Meghalaya murder case. He has personally tracked and discussed with his close circle the updates on the details. There might be a development on the subject from his production too.' Despite the media speculation, Khan and his production house have made no official announcements linking them to the case or any project based on it. The lack of concrete confirmation did little to stop the rumour mill from spinning—until now. As it stands, Khan appears to have no involvement—creative or otherwise—with any film related to the Meghalaya murder case. His focus, for now, remains on upcoming projects that have been officially announced. Aamir Khan was last seen in 'Sitaare Zameen Par', which was an official remake of the 2018 Spanish film, 'Campeones'. It is also a spiritual sequel to 'Taare Zameen Par'. Directed by RS Prasanna, the film followed a suspended basketball coach who must serve community service by helping a team of players with disabilities prepare for a tournament.
